Home Chemical Details 38695-71-5
METHYL 4-PHENYLTHIOPHENE-3-CARBOXYLATE
Methyl 4-phenylthiophene-3-carboxylate 97%
48-49
Monday - Saturday: 9am - 6pm IST
Become a premium member
with us